Unable to install zenarmor on Pfsense 2.8.1
Hi there,
Whenever I try to install zenarmor on the latest pfsense 2.8.1 I get this error:
I do have a good WAN connection, so this cannot be the problem. Does anyone have an idea why this could happen? I tried to check whatever is going wrong on new installations because I have one zenarmor instance running on our own production pfsense firewall that is still running pfsense 2.8.0 CE, but the freebsd version is the same.
_____ _____ _ _ _ ____ __ __ ___ ____
|__ /| ____|| \ | | / \ | _ \ | \/ | / _ \ | _ \
/ / | _| | \| | / _ \ | |_) || |\/| || | | || |_) |
/ /_ | |___ | |\ | / ___ \ | _ < | | | || |_| || _ <
/____||_____||_| \_|/_/ \_\|_| \_\|_| |_| \___/ |_| \_\
Detected Operating System
-------------------------
Name : FreeBSD
Version : 15.0-CURRENT
Installing for FreeBSD...
Updating pfSense-core repository catalogue...
Fetching meta.conf:
Fetching data.pkg:
pfSense-core repository is up to date.
Updating pfSense repository catalogue...
Fetching meta.conf:
Fetching data.pkg:
pfSense repository is up to date.
All repositories are up to date.
Checking integrity... done (0 conflicting)
The most recent versions of packages are already installed
Updating SunnyValley repository catalogue...
Fetching meta.conf: . done
Fetching data.pkg: . done
Processing entries: . done
SunnyValley repository update completed. 3 packages processed.
Updating pfSense-core repository catalogue...
Fetching meta.conf: . done
Fetching data.pkg: . done
Processing entries: . done
pfSense-core repository update completed. 4 packages processed.
Updating pfSense repository catalogue...
Fetching meta.conf: . done
Fetching data.pkg: ......... done
Processing entries: .......... done
pfSense repository update completed. 541 packages processed.
All repositories are up to date.
Updating SunnyValley repository catalogue...
Fetching meta.conf:
Fetching data.pkg:
SunnyValley repository is up to date.
Updating pfSense-core repository catalogue...
Fetching meta.conf:
Fetching data.pkg:
pfSense-core repository is up to date.
Updating pfSense repository catalogue...
Fetching meta.conf:
Fetching data.pkg:
pfSense repository is up to date.
All repositories are up to date.
Checking integrity... done (0 conflicting)
The following 1 package(s) will be affected (of 0 checked):
Installed packages to be REINSTALLED:
zenarmor-2.5 [SunnyValley]
Number of packages to be reinstalled: 1
[1/1] Reinstalling zenarmor-2.5...
[1/1] Extracting zenarmor-2.5: .......... done
Generating Default CA keys and certificates...done
Copy block tamplate ...Creating user_device_cache.db...
done
Updating SunnyValley repository catalogue...
Fetching meta.conf:
Fetching data.pkg:
SunnyValley repository is up to date.
Updating pfSense-core repository catalogue...
Fetching meta.conf:
Fetching data.pkg:
pfSense-core repository is up to date.
Updating pfSense repository catalogue...
Fetching meta.conf:
Fetching data.pkg:
pfSense repository is up to date.
All repositories are up to date.
Checking integrity... done (0 conflicting)
The following 1 package(s) will be affected (of 0 checked):
Installed packages to be REINSTALLED:
zenarmor-agent-2.5 [SunnyValley]
Number of packages to be reinstalled: 1
[1/1] Reinstalling zenarmor-agent-2.5...
[1/1] Extracting zenarmor-agent-2.5: .......... done
Post-installation script started.
Needrestart drop-in file already exists: /etc/needrestart/conf.d/no-restart-eastpect.conf
-----------------------------✓ SUCCESS ✓------------------------------
Installation finished successfully.
Registering your firewall gateway to Zenconsole Cloud Management Portal...
runtime: lfstack.push invalid packing: node=0x4274b719bbe0c0 cnt=0x1 packed=0x74b719bbe0c00001 -> node=0x74b719bbe0c0
fatal error: lfstack.push
runtime stack:
runtime.throw({0x807853?, 0x2000?})
/usr/local/go/src/runtime/panic.go:1101 +0x48 fp=0x82441cc60 sp=0x82441cc30 pc=0x2186d28
runtime.(*lfstack).push(0x3ef1f20?, 0x1?)
/usr/local/go/src/runtime/lfstack.go:29 +0x125 fp=0x82441cca0 sp=0x82441cc60 pc=0x212a705
runtime.(*spanSetBlockAlloc).free(...)
/usr/local/go/src/runtime/mspanset.go:322
runtime.(*spanSet).reset(0x3f0fa00)
/usr/local/go/src/runtime/mspanset.go:264 +0x79 fp=0x82441ccd0 sp=0x82441cca0 pc=0x214c9b9
runtime.finishsweep_m()
/usr/local/go/src/runtime/mgcsweep.go:256 +0x92 fp=0x82441cd08 sp=0x82441ccd0 pc=0x213f832
runtime.gcStart.func3()
/usr/local/go/src/runtime/mgc.go:734 +0xf fp=0x82441cd18 sp=0x82441cd08 pc=0x218238f
runtime.systemstack(0x82441cd50)
/usr/local/go/src/runtime/asm_amd64.s:514 +0x4a fp=0x82441cd28 sp=0x82441cd18 pc=0x218d10a
goroutine 1 gp=0x870002380 m=0 mp=0x3ef4840 [running, locked to thread]:
runtime.systemstack_switch()
/usr/local/go/src/runtime/asm_amd64.s:479 +0x8 fp=0x87071f6f8 sp=0x87071f6e8 pc=0x218d0a8
runtime.gcStart({0x4274b719a43108?, 0xc?, 0x7071f838?})
/usr/local/go/src/runtime/mgc.go:733 +0x40b fp=0x87071f7f0 sp=0x87071f6f8 pc=0x213464b
runtime.mallocgcSmallScanNoHeader(0x40, 0x5b12e0, 0xe8?)
/usr/local/go/src/runtime/malloc.go:1425 +0x2f4 fp=0x87071f850 sp=0x87071f7f0 pc=0x212ce34
runtime.mallocgc(0x40, 0x5b12e0, 0x1)
/usr/local/go/src/runtime/malloc.go:1058 +0x99 fp=0x87071f880 sp=0x87071f850 pc=0x21849f9
runtime.growslice(0x8709e5760, 0x2724745?, 0x870a26200?, 0x870a28930?, 0x5b12e0)
/usr/local/go/src/runtime/slice.go:272 +0x55d fp=0x87071f8f0 sp=0x87071f880 pc=0x2189b3d
regexp/syntax.(*parser).collapse(0x870a26200, {0x8709b3f40, 0x6, 0x87071f9c0?}, 0x12)
/usr/local/go/src/regexp/syntax/parse.go:559 +0x1bf fp=0x87071f988 sp=0x87071f8f0 pc=0x2725a1f
regexp/syntax.(*parser).concat(0x870a26200)
/usr/local/go/src/regexp/syntax/parse.go:492 +0x13b fp=0x87071f9d0 sp=0x87071f988 pc=0x27254bb
regexp/syntax.parse({0x81df25, 0x17}, 0xd4)
/usr/local/go/src/regexp/syntax/parse.go:1084 +0x103d fp=0x87071fad0 sp=0x87071f9d0 pc=0x27287fd
regexp/syntax.Parse(...)
/usr/local/go/src/regexp/syntax/parse.go:887
regexp.compile({0x81df25, 0x17}, 0x6870?, 0x0)
/usr/local/go/src/regexp/regexp.go:168 +0x30 fp=0x87071fb58 sp=0x87071fad0 pc=0x2736810
regexp.Compile(...)
/usr/local/go/src/regexp/regexp.go:131
regexp.MustCompile({0x81df25, 0x17})
/usr/local/go/src/regexp/regexp.go:311 +0x2c fp=0x87071fbd0 sp=0x87071fb58 pc=0x273736c
github.com/charmbracelet/bubbletea.init()
/jenkins/workspace/os-sensei-agent-release-2.5/vendor/github.com/charmbracelet/bubbletea/key.go:611 +0x6f fp=0x87071fe28 sp=0x87071fbd0 pc=0x390f14f
runtime.doInit1(0x3dae790)
/usr/local/go/src/runtime/proc.go:7410 +0xc7 fp=0x87071ff50 sp=0x87071fe28 pc=0x2162ec7
runtime.doInit(...)
/usr/local/go/src/runtime/proc.go:7377
runtime.main()
/usr/local/go/src/runtime/proc.go:254 +0x330 fp=0x87071ffe0 sp=0x87071ff50 pc=0x2154650
runtime.goexit({})
/usr/local/go/src/runtime/asm_amd64.s:1700 +0x1 fp=0x87071ffe8 sp=0x87071ffe0 pc=0x218f0c1
goroutine 2 gp=0x870002e00 m=nil [force gc (idle)]:
runtime.gopark(0x0?, 0x0?, 0x0?, 0x0?, 0x0?)
/usr/local/go/src/runtime/proc.go:435 +0xce fp=0x870066fa8 sp=0x870066f88 pc=0x2186e4e
runtime.goparkunlock(...)
/usr/local/go/src/runtime/proc.go:441
runtime.forcegchelper()
/usr/local/go/src/runtime/proc.go:348 +0xa5 fp=0x870066fe0 sp=0x870066fa8 pc=0x21548c5
runtime.goexit({})
/usr/local/go/src/runtime/asm_amd64.s:1700 +0x1 fp=0x870066fe8 sp=0x870066fe0 pc=0x218f0c1
created by runtime.init.7 in goroutine 1
/usr/local/go/src/runtime/proc.go:336 +0x1a
goroutine 3 gp=0x870002fc0 m=nil [runnable]:
runtime.gopark(0x0?, 0x0?, 0x0?, 0x0?, 0x0?)
/usr/local/go/src/runtime/proc.go:435 +0xce fp=0x870067780 sp=0x870067760 pc=0x2186e4e
runtime.goparkunlock(...)
/usr/local/go/src/runtime/proc.go:441
runtime.bgsweep(0x87007e000)
/usr/local/go/src/runtime/mgcsweep.go:276 +0x94 fp=0x8700677c8 sp=0x870067780 pc=0x213f914
runtime.gcenable.gowrap1()
/usr/local/go/src/runtime/mgc.go:204 +0x25 fp=0x8700677e0 sp=0x8700677c8 pc=0x2133e85
runtime.goexit({})
/usr/local/go/src/runtime/asm_amd64.s:1700 +0x1 fp=0x8700677e8 sp=0x8700677e0 pc=0x218f0c1
created by runtime.gcenable in goroutine 1
/usr/local/go/src/runtime/mgc.go:204 +0x66
goroutine 4 gp=0x870003180 m=nil [runnable]:
runtime.gopark(0x87007e000?, 0xbae150?, 0x1?, 0x0?, 0x870003180?)
/usr/local/go/src/runtime/proc.go:435 +0xce fp=0x870067f78 sp=0x870067f58 pc=0x2186e4e
runtime.goparkunlock(...)
/usr/local/go/src/runtime/proc.go:441
runtime.(*scavengerState).park(0x3ef0f80)
/usr/local/go/src/runtime/mgcscavenge.go:425 +0x49 fp=0x870067fa8 sp=0x870067f78 pc=0x213d3c9
runtime.bgscavenge(0x87007e000)
/usr/local/go/src/runtime/mgcscavenge.go:653 +0x3c fp=0x870067fc8 sp=0x870067fa8 pc=0x213d91c
runtime.gcenable.gowrap2()
/usr/local/go/src/runtime/mgc.go:205 +0x25 fp=0x870067fe0 sp=0x870067fc8 pc=0x2133e25
runtime.goexit({})
/usr/local/go/src/runtime/asm_amd64.s:1700 +0x1 fp=0x870067fe8 sp=0x870067fe0 pc=0x218f0c1
created by runtime.gcenable in goroutine 1
/usr/local/go/src/runtime/mgc.go:205 +0xa5
goroutine 5 gp=0x870003dc0 m=nil [runnable]:
runtime.runfinq()
/usr/local/go/src/runtime/mfinal.go:179 fp=0x8700667e0 sp=0x8700667d8 pc=0x2132d40
runtime.goexit({})
/usr/local/go/src/runtime/asm_amd64.s:1700 +0x1 fp=0x8700667e8 sp=0x8700667e0 pc=0x218f0c1
created by runtime.createfing in goroutine 1
/usr/local/go/src/runtime/mfinal.go:166 +0x3d
goroutine 6 gp=0x870136000 m=nil [GC worker (idle)]:
runtime.gopark(0x0?, 0x0?, 0x0?, 0x0?, 0x0?)
/usr/local/go/src/runtime/proc.go:435 +0xce fp=0x870068738 sp=0x870068718 pc=0x2186e4e
runtime.gcBgMarkWorker(0x87009e150)
/usr/local/go/src/runtime/mgc.go:1423 +0xe9 fp=0x8700687c8 sp=0x870068738 pc=0x2136269
runtime.gcBgMarkStartWorkers.gowrap1()
/usr/local/go/src/runtime/mgc.go:1339 +0x25 fp=0x8700687e0 sp=0x8700687c8 pc=0x2136145
runtime.goexit({})
/usr/local/go/src/runtime/asm_amd64.s:1700 +0x1 fp=0x8700687e8 sp=0x8700687e0 pc=0x218f0c1
created by runtime.gcBgMarkStartWorkers in goroutine 1
/usr/local/go/src/runtime/mgc.go:1339 +0x105
goroutine 7 gp=0x8701368c0 m=nil [runnable]:
go.opencensus.io/stats/view.init.0.gowrap1()
/jenkins/workspace/os-sensei-agent-release-2.5/vendor/go.opencensus.io/stats/view/worker.go:34 fp=0x870063fe0 sp=0x870063fd8 pc=0x37e1060
runtime.goexit({})
/usr/local/go/src/runtime/asm_amd64.s:1700 +0x1 fp=0x870063fe8 sp=0x870063fe0 pc=0x218f0c1
created by go.opencensus.io/stats/view.init.0 in goroutine 1
/jenkins/workspace/os-sensei-agent-release-2.5/vendor/go.opencensus.io/stats/view/worker.go:34 +0x8d
goroutine 8 gp=0x870136a80 m=nil [runnable]:
runtime.unique_runtime_registerUniqueMapCleanup.gowrap1()
/usr/local/go/src/runtime/mgc.go:1795 fp=0x8700647e0 sp=0x8700647d8 pc=0x2136f00
runtime.goexit({})
/usr/local/go/src/runtime/asm_amd64.s:1700 +0x1 fp=0x8700647e8 sp=0x8700647e0 pc=0x218f0c1
created by unique.runtime_registerUniqueMapCleanup in goroutine 1
/usr/local/go/src/runtime/mgc.go:1795 +0x79
------------------------------! ERROR !-------------------------------
Registration to Zenconsole was unsuccessful.
Please verify that your internet connection is stable,
and that the installation script is valid, then try again.
Kind regards,
Kind regards,
Tim
-
Hi Tim,
Thank you for reaching out and bringing this to our attention.
Are you using the installation script in Zenconsole - Global Deployment or "curl https://updates.zenarmor.net/getzenarmor | sh"?
Please sign in to leave a comment.
Comments
1 comment